排序
python中如何導入numpy python科學計算庫引入
在python中導入numpy只需一行代碼:import numpy as np。1. 導入后,可以進行數組創建、矩陣運算等。2. numpy高效處理大量數據,性能優于python列表。3. 使用時注意元素-wise操作和廣播機制。4....
python中的sum是什么意思 python求和函數sum的迭代用法
sum函數在python中可以結合迭代器使用。1. 基本用法:sum(numbers)計算列表和。2. 高級用法:sum(x**2 for x in numbers)計算平方和。3. 嵌套列表:sum(sum(inner) for inner in nested_list)計...
pycharm怎么開始編程 編程入門基礎操作解析
在 pycharm 中開始編程需要以下步驟:1. 打開 pycharm,選擇 'create new project',選擇 'pure python' 并創建項目。2. 右鍵項目文件夾,選擇 'new' -> 'python file',創建并命名文件如 'h...
Redis與RabbitMQ的性能對比與聯合應用場景
redis和rabbitmq在性能和聯合應用場景中各有優勢。1. redis在數據讀寫上表現出色,延遲低至微秒級,適合高并發場景。2. rabbitmq專注于消息傳遞,延遲在毫秒級,支持多隊列和消費者模型。3. 聯...
python中index是什么 python索引定位方法解析
python中索引定位的方法包括index方法、切片和負索引。1) index方法用于查找序列中某個元素的第一個出現位置,若元素不存在會引發valueerror。2) 切片和負索引提供更靈活的定位方式,切片用于獲...
Python中如何使用Django REST框架?
在django項目中使用drf需要以下步驟:1. 通過pip安裝djangorestframework。2. 在settings.py中添加'rest_framework'到installed_apps。3. 為模型創建序列化器,如bookserializer。4. 使用apivie...
如何在Python中實現運算符重載?
在python中實現運算符重載可以通過重寫特殊方法(魔術方法)來實現。具體步驟如下:1. 定義類并重寫相應的魔術方法,如__add__用于加法。2. 在方法中實現運算邏輯并返回新對象。3. 注意對稱性、...
python中如何判斷素數 python質數判斷算法的實現
在python中,判斷一個數是否為素數可以使用試除法。具體步驟包括:1) 排除小于等于1的數;2) 特別處理2,因為2是唯一的偶數素數;3) 檢查是否能被2整除;4) 從3開始,逐步增加奇數,檢查到平方...
如何在Python中創建SQLite數據庫?
在python中創建sqlite數據庫使用sqlite3模塊,步驟如下:1. 連接到數據庫,2. 創建游標對象,3. 創建表,4. 提交事務,5. 關閉連接。這不僅簡單易行,還包含了優化和注意事項,如使用索引和批量...
python中object是什么意思 python所有類的基類object解析
在python中,object是所有類的基類。1) object是所有類的終極父類,2) 它定義了基本的行為和方法,如__str__()、__new__()、__init__()等,3) 它支持python的多態性和動態類型系統,4) 在使用時...
Python中如何計算列表長度?
在python中計算列表長度的最簡單方法是使用len()函數。1) len()函數適用于列表、字符串、元組、字典等,返回元素數量。2) 自定義長度計算函數雖然可行,但效率低,不建議在實際應用中使用。3) ...